Meaning and Definition

bad (bad) n-m. 1. (properly) separation 2. (by implication) a part of the body, branch of a tree, bar for carrying 3. (figuratively) chief of a city 4. (especially, with prepositional prefix as an adverb) apart, only, besides [from H909] KJV: alone, apart, bar, besides, branch, by self, of each alike, except, only, part, staff, strength. Root(s): H909

Original Word
בַּד
Transliteration
bad
Derivation
Root: בדד First root strongs: 909
Morphology
noun masc

Extended Strong's Hebrew Lexicon (Brown-Driver-Briggs based)

alone: pole

Usage: : pole 1) alone, by itself, besides, a part, separation, being alone 1a) separation, alone, by itself 1a1) only (adv) 1a2) apart from, besides (prep) 1b) part 1c) parts (eg limbs, shoots), bars

STEPBible · Tyndale House, Cambridge · CC BY 4.0
